What price Smalltalk
Journal Article
·
· Computer; (United States)
In anticipation of the promise of tremendous hardware advances, software researchers have fashioned expansive programming environments to improve programmer productivity. Even with the march of technology, exploratory programming environments such as Smalltalk-80 require such expensive computers that few programmers can afford them. With the hope of increasing that community, a research project at the University of California created a reduced instruction set computer for Smalltalk called SOAR, which stands for Smalltalk on a RISC. The authors are now able to estimate the performance implications of the Smalltalk-80 programming environment. In the next section the authors list the demands that Smalltalk-80 places on traditional computer systems, then present software and hardware ideas that answer those demands.
- Research Organization:
- Stanford Univ.
- OSTI ID:
- 6832410
- Journal Information:
- Computer; (United States), Journal Name: Computer; (United States) Vol. 20:1; ISSN CPTRB
- Country of Publication:
- United States
- Language:
- English
Similar Records
First steps toward a compilation from Smalltalk-80 to C(LOS)
Nuclear material control and accounting by process simulation with smalltalk
Lisp on a reduced-instruction-set processor: Characterization and optimization
Conference
·
Sat Dec 30 23:00:00 EST 1995
·
OSTI ID:210048
Nuclear material control and accounting by process simulation with smalltalk
Conference
·
Tue Dec 31 23:00:00 EST 1985
· Nucl. Mater. Manage. Annu. Meet. Proc.; (United States)
·
OSTI ID:5052653
Lisp on a reduced-instruction-set processor: Characterization and optimization
Journal Article
·
Fri Jul 01 00:00:00 EDT 1988
· Computer; (United States)
·
OSTI ID:7177768
Related Subjects
99 GENERAL AND MISCELLANEOUS
990210* -- Supercomputers-- (1987-1989)
COMPUTER ARCHITECTURE
COMPUTER CODES
COMPUTERS
DIGITAL COMPUTERS
ELECTRONIC CIRCUITS
MICROELECTRONIC CIRCUITS
MICROPROCESSORS
MOS TRANSISTORS
PERFORMANCE
PROGRAMMING
PROGRAMMING LANGUAGES
RESEARCH PROGRAMS
SEMICONDUCTOR DEVICES
SUPERCOMPUTERS
TRANSISTORS
990210* -- Supercomputers-- (1987-1989)
COMPUTER ARCHITECTURE
COMPUTER CODES
COMPUTERS
DIGITAL COMPUTERS
ELECTRONIC CIRCUITS
MICROELECTRONIC CIRCUITS
MICROPROCESSORS
MOS TRANSISTORS
PERFORMANCE
PROGRAMMING
PROGRAMMING LANGUAGES
RESEARCH PROGRAMS
SEMICONDUCTOR DEVICES
SUPERCOMPUTERS
TRANSISTORS